WebOct 31, 2024 · With the involute function many geometric gear parameters can be calculated. inv(α) = tan(α) − α = φ involute function All angles for the involute function must always be given in radians! Operating pressure … As Figure 3.5 shows, a gear with 20 degrees of pressure angle and 10 teeth will have a huge undercut volume. To prevent undercut, a positive correction must be introduced. A positive correction, as in Figure 3.6, can prevent undercut. Undercutting will get worse if a negative correction is applied. The definition of involute curve is the curve traced by a point on a straight line which rolls without slipping on the circle. The circle is called the base circleof the involutes.
